Skip to main content

ConfigEngine scripts fail with message: Configuration Engine is currently locked!"


Technote (troubleshooting)


Problem

Websphere Portal 8 ConfigEngine scripts fail immediately with the following message:

"Configuration Engine is currently locked! Please wait for the current process to finish before attempting to execute another configuration"


Symptom

<wp_profile-root>/ConfigEngine/log/ConfigTrace.log displays the following when running the ConfigEngine script (for example with the migration script 'upgrade-profile'):

Running configuration tasks: iseries-switch-user upgrade-profile

Command line arguments: -buildfile base.xml -listener -listener -Dcfg.trace=<wp-profile>/ConfigEngine/log/ConfigTrace.log -Dwas.install.root=<WAS-INSTALL-DIR> -DNodeName=<NodeName> -DCellName=<CELL NAME> -Dwas.repository.root=<WP-PROFILE-DIR>/config -Dserver.root=<WAS-INSTALL-DIR> -DisIseries=true -Dlocal.cell=<DMGR-CELL> -Dlocal.node=<PORTAL NDE> -DjvmArgFor64bit=-D64bit.args=none -Dwas.user.root=<WP-PROFILE-DIR> -Duser.install.root=<WP-PROFILE-DIR> -DEngineRootDir=<ConfigEngine-Binary-Dir> -DProfileRootDir=<WP-PROFILE-DIR>-Dplatform.script.ext=sh -Dwas.platform.script.ext= -DInstance=<PORTAL-INSTANCE-NAME> -DInstanceParm=-profileName iseries-switch-user upgrade-profile -DWasPassword=PASSWORD_REMOVED -DPortalAdminPwd=PASSWORD_REMOVED -DdbSafeMode=false -Dwcm.transactionTimeout=3600
Configuration Engine is currently locked! Please wait for the current process to finish before attempting to execute another configuration
BUILD FAILED

Cause

There are 2 Potential causes for this error

1) There is another ConfigEngine task running on the system

Solution:

- Wait for this ConfigEngine Task is finished before executing the ConfigEngine upgrade-profile migration task

2) A previous ConfigEngine Task terminated prematurely and a .lck file exists in the the <wp_profile>/ConfigEngine directory

Solution:

- Open the <wp_profile>/ConfigEngine directory

- Remove all files with the .lck extenstion and re-run the ConfigEngine ... upgrade-profile task

Environment

WebSphere Portal 8.x

Diagnosing the problem

1) View the <wp_profile-root>/ConfigEngine/log/ConfigTrace.log for the Build Failed Message

2) The Line above the Build Failed Message will display the text
Configuration Engine is currently locked! Please wait for the current process to finish before attempting to execute another configuration
3) Check for other run ConfigEngine Processes
4) If there is no other ConfigEngine Processes running navigate to the <wp_profile>/ConfigEngine directory an search for *.lck and remove them if they exists

Resolving the problem

1) If there is another ConfigEngine task running on the system wait for the task is finished before executing the ConfigEngine upgrade-profile migration task

2) If there is not another ConfigEgineTask running on the system, navigate to the <wp_profile>/ConfigEngine directory and remove all files with the .lck extension and re-run the ConfigEngine script.


Rate this page:

(0 users)Average rating

Copyright and trademark information

IBM, the IBM logo and ibm.com are trademarks of International Business Machines Corp., registered in many jurisdictions worldwide. Other product and service names might be trademarks of IBM or other companies. A current list of IBM trademarks is available on the Web at "Copyright and trademark information" at www.ibm.com/legal/copytrade.shtml.

Rate this page:


(0 users)Average rating

Add comments

Document information

WebSphere Portal

Migration


Software version:
8.0, 8.0.0.0, 8.0.0.1


Operating system(s):
AIX, IBM i, Linux, Solaris, Windows, z/OS


Software edition:
Enable, Express, Extend, Server


Reference #:
1631306


Modified date:
2013-04-12

Translate my page

Content navigation